Wine makes for a beautiful beef sauce. Just add some butter and red wine in a saucepan. Let the sauce simmer and thicken, allowing a portion of the alcohol to cook out. Once the sauce is ready, add just a bit to your beef dish.

Wines and desserts go well together, as there are many different combinations. Dessert wines tend to be sweeter than other wines. Ruby and tawny ports are just two varieties that provide an authentic sweetness which works well with desserts. Serve them at approximately 55 degrees for best flavor.

Red and white wines differ in the temperature they are served best at. Red wine is usually served at a warmer temperature than white wine with a difference of about 10 degrees. One way to chill wine that’s white is to put it in the fridge first and after that just let it sit for a couple of minutes. Try to get reds at 60 degrees Fahrenheit, and whites around 45.
